When Do You Need a Group Facilitator?
You Need to Pivot With Confidence
We have the experience to know what might work and what needs to change when something doesn’t go to plan.
We Love This Stuff – Start to Finish
We are obsessed with the design and delivery of facilitated sessions. The same passion and expertise your organization puts into your goals and work, we will do for setting up the right conversations and activities that will help you meet our team gathering goals.
You Need a Neutral Outsider
Someone else to come in as a neutral outsider and help drive the group to have a more successful conversation, decision, collaborative effort or process.
The Power Dynamic Needs to Be More Neutral
Key leaders understand that their power dynamic of being the “boss” might influence the group in some way, but they want the group to feel comfortable and safe to speak up and share information. Having a facilitator takes the “lead” role from the key leadership person (or people) and helps to focus the group away from people and onto the goals of the session.
